I understand Disney wants people to go direct, but what they really want is to earn money. If nobody is going to purchase this upgrade, there is no point in offering it. By offering an upgrade fee that is somewhere between the price of Resale and Direct pricing, people will utilize this service. Disney basically gets free money without having to take on inventory, pay maintenance fees, plus selling commissions to sales people. The resale company does all the work, and Disney still earns a chunk of cash without investing any capital. Its the perfect scenario for them.
Add to that, if the resale restrictions do in fact drive prices down, that just creates more room for Disney to profit from this strategy.
I can see them not offering this on in-market resorts because they don't want to take away sales from themselves. But it makes perfect sense for them to offer this on sold out resorts.
